Output d9994bd6e24fece0657344446c173c9c26850f3530588e016e18aefa9e03dcac:0

value
689844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f63e73de88bd06dd9cf7807360bf158f664c22d OP_EQUAL
address
34YzYtjBRiJr2YmLka8SuJb8TBsciPpKYS
transaction
d9994bd6e24fece0657344446c173c9c26850f3530588e016e18aefa9e03dcac
spent
true